Common challenges when adopting proposal apps

  • Meeting HIPAA and FERPA requirements while enabling electronic signatures across diverse systems can require legal review and an executed BAA.
  • Integrating proposal workflows with EHRs or scheduling systems often needs API work and careful mapping of patient and payer data fields.
  • Maintaining version control and reconciliation between signed proposals, contracts, and billing records introduces operational complexity for clinical and administrative teams.
  • Ensuring signer identity for high-risk agreements without creating friction for patients or external stakeholders can complicate implementation choices.

Essential features to evaluate in proposal apps

When selecting a proposal app for healthcare, prioritize capabilities that support compliance, repeatability, and integration with clinical and administrative systems.

eSignature

Legally valid electronic signatures with ESIGN and UETA compliance plus configurable signer authentication options.

Templates

Reusable, versioned proposal templates that include conditional content, required disclosures, and signable fields for consistent proposals.

Bulk Send

Send identical proposals to many recipients with individualized data fields and per-recipient tracking for mass outreach.

Integrations

Pre-built connectors to CRM, document storage, and some EHR systems to synchronize records and reduce duplicate data entry.

Conditional Logic

Show or hide sections and fields based on responses to streamline proposals for different services or payers.

Audit Trail

Comprehensive, tamper-evident logs capturing signer events, IP addresses, timestamps, and document versions.

Device and platform requirements for signing

Most proposal apps support current web browsers and native mobile apps for signing and management.

  • Desktop browsers: Recent Chrome, Edge, Safari
  • Mobile OS: iOS 14+ and Android 9+
  • Offline access: Limited or app-dependent

Ensure devices are updated and corporate mobile management policies allow secure app installation; enable device encryption and screen locks to protect PHI on mobile devices.

Best practices for secure, accurate healthcare proposals

Adopt standard operating procedures to minimize risk and maximize consistency when sending healthcare proposals.

Use approved, version-controlled templates
Maintain a central library of legally reviewed proposal templates with version history, controlled editing permissions, and a clear approval workflow to prevent unauthorized changes and ensure compliance with institutional policies.
Enforce least-privilege access
Grant signing and template management rights only to necessary roles; require multi-factor authentication for administrative accounts to reduce the chance of credential compromise and unauthorized document changes.
Document retention and BAAs
Execute Business Associate Agreements where PHI is involved and apply retention schedules consistent with HIPAA and institutional policy; ensure backups and exportability for legal review.
Log and monitor activity
Regularly review audit logs for anomalies, configure alerts for unusual access patterns, and retain exportable evidence to support dispute resolution or compliance audits.
